                                                              Shivaji

                 Shivaji was born in A.D. 1627 at Poona. His father Shahji Bhonsle was a chief at the
                 court of Bijapur. Shivaji lived with his mother Jijabai at Poona. Dadaji Kondev was his
                 guide and teacher who greatly influenced him. Shivaji was also much influenced by
                 the religious sentiments of his mother. She narrated to him the heroic stories of the
                 Ramayana and the Mahabharata.
                 Shivaji was a brave soldier. He started his career as the leader of a small band of dedicated Maratha
                 warriors, which grew into a large disciplined army.
                 Shivaji perfected the art of guerilla warfare. His soldiers would pounce upon the Mughal armies and
                 disappear before they could move into action. The hilly Deccan terrain suited them for such a warfare.
